1. Core Difference Between Solid & Hollow Rod

Solid Chrome Rod

  • Full solid steel structure

  • Higher rigidity & bending resistance

  • Standard for most general & heavy-duty cylinders

Chrome Hollow Rod

  • Hollow center, lighter weight

  • Better heat dissipation & stability

  • Ideal for long stroke, high speed, low-temperature conditions

2.Performance Comparison (Key Data)

Item

Solid Chrome Rod

Hollow Chrome Rod

Weight

Heavier

Lighter (15–40% lighter)

Bending Resistance

Stronger

Good (with sufficient wall thickness)

Heat Dissipation

Normal

Excellent

Low-Temperature Stability

Good

Better (less thermal stress)

Suitable Stroke

Short – Medium

Medium – Long

3. When to Use Solid Chrome Rod

  • Heavy-duty, high-load working conditions

  • Short or medium stroke cylinders

  • Excavators, forklifts, loaders, construction machinery

  • Materials: CK45, 42CrMo, 20MnV6

4. When to Use Chrome Hollow Rod

  • Long-stroke hydraulic cylinders

  • High-speed reciprocating motion

  • Low-temperature environments (–20°C to –40°C)

  • Lightweight & energy-saving equipment

  • Sanitation trucks, aerial platforms, telescopic cylinders, wind power systems

  • Best material: 20MnV6 (high toughness + low temp resistance)

5. Key Quality Standards You Must Verify

  • OD Tolerance: ISO f7

  • Surface Roughness: Ra ≤ 0.2 μm

  • Chrome Thickness: 25 μm ±5 μm

  • Surface Hardness: HV800 min.

  • Straightness: 0.2–0.5 mm/m

  • Materials: CK45, 20MnV6, 42CrMo

6. Material Recommendation by EAST AI

For normal conditions: CK45

For low-temperature & long life: 20MnV6

For ultra-high pressure & heavy duty: 42CrMo

Conclusion|

Choose solid chrome rod for heavy-duty, short-stroke cylinders.

Choose hollow chrome rod for long-stroke, high-speed, low-temperature systems.

For best low-temperature performance, use 20MnV6.
